scheu       2002/09/27 09:35:46

  Modified:    java/src/org/apache/axis/wsdl/fromJava Emitter.java
  Log:
  use parameters in J2W wrapped mode...for .NET
  
  Revision  Changes    Path
  1.67      +5 -6      xml-axis/java/src/org/apache/axis/wsdl/fromJava/Emitter.java
  
  Index: Emitter.java
  ===================================================================
  RCS file: /home/cvs/xml-axis/java/src/org/apache/axis/wsdl/fromJava/Emitter.java,v
  retrieving revision 1.66
  retrieving revision 1.67
  diff -u -r1.66 -r1.67
  --- Emitter.java      27 Sep 2002 16:23:13 -0000      1.66
  +++ Emitter.java      27 Sep 2002 16:35:45 -0000      1.67
  @@ -1147,12 +1147,11 @@
                                                 param.getName(),
                                                 typeQName)) {
                       // If wrapper element is written
  -                    // add <part name="body/return" element=wrapper_elem />
  -                    if (request) {
  -                        part.setName("body");
  -                    } else {
  -                        part.setName("return");
  -                    }
  +                    // add <part name="parameters" element=wrapper_elem />
  +                    // Really shouldn't matter what name is used, but
  +                    // .NET could be using "parameters" as an indication
  +                    // that this is wrapped mode.
  +                    part.setName("parameters");
                       part.setElementName(wrapperQName);
                       msg.addPart(part);
                   }
  
  
  


Reply via email to